Output e6c52b381c56ecd883f494c80b2a749b26e721ebd1da34c85839cbe1c83032de:14

value
2935052
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ca4b317f5a184f65720ed480e1631397a0e22619 OP_EQUAL
address
3L8eVpTQv53gPa1SQP8TJ7kVFWL1gJMiC9
transaction
e6c52b381c56ecd883f494c80b2a749b26e721ebd1da34c85839cbe1c83032de
confirmations
254272
spent
true